[PATCH] e1000e: fix heap overflow in e1000_set_eeprom()

The ETHTOOL_SETEEPROM ioctl copies user data into a kmalloc'ed buffer
without validating eeprom->len and eeprom->offset. A CAP_NET_ADMIN
user can overflow the heap and crash the kernel or gain code execution.

Validate length and offset before kmalloc() to avoid leaking eeprom_buff.

@@ -569,6 +569,10 @@ static int e1000_set_eeprom(struct net_device *netdev,
 
 	max_len = hw->nvm.word_size * 2;
 
+	/* bounds check: offset + len must not exceed EEPROM size */
+	if (eeprom->offset + eeprom->len > max_len)
+		return -EINVAL;
+
 	first_word = eeprom->offset >> 1;
 	last_word = (eeprom->offset + eeprom->len - 1) >> 1;
 	eeprom_buff = kmalloc(max_len, GFP_KERNEL);
@@ -596,9 +600,6 @@ static int e1000_set_eeprom(struct net_device *netdev,
 	for (i = 0; i < last_word - first_word + 1; i++)
 		le16_to_cpus(&eeprom_buff[i]);
 
-        if (eeprom->len > max_len ||
-            eeprom->offset > max_len - eeprom->len)
-                return -EINVAL;
 	memcpy(ptr, bytes, eeprom->len);
